de_DEen_USes_ESfr_FRjapl_PLpt_PTru_RUvizh_CNzh_TW

Menyederhanakan Analisis Kebutuhan: Panduan Lengkap tentang Deskripsi Kasus Penggunaan yang Dibuat oleh AI

UncategorizedYesterday

Pengantar Pengumpulan Kebutuhan Modern

Dalam siklus pengembangan perangkat lunak dan manajemen proyek, fondasi produk yang sukses terletak pada kebutuhan yang jelas dan terstruktur. Secara tradisional, membuatdeskripsi dan diagram kasus penggunaanadalah proses yang memakan banyak tenaga, rentan terhadap kesalahan manusia dan ambiguitas. Namun, integrasi Kecerdasan Buatan ke dalam analisis kebutuhan telah merevolusi alur kerja ini. Panduan komprehensif ini mengeksplorasi cara memanfaatkan alat AI untuk mengubah ide proyek yang abstrak menjadi blueprints profesional dan dapat dijalankan, memastikan tim Anda memulai dengan fondasi yang kuat.

Konsep Kunci

Sebelum terjun ke alur kerja otomatis, sangat penting untuk memahami terminologi inti yang digunakan alat AI untuk mengatur dokumentasi Anda.

  • Kasus Penggunaan:Suatu situasi tertentu di mana produk atau sistem kemungkinan digunakan. Ini menggambarkan interaksi antara aktor dan sistem untuk mencapai tujuan tertentu.
  • Aktor:Entitas yang berinteraksi dengan sistem. Ini bisa berupa pengguna manusia (misalnya, Administrator, Pelanggan) atau sistem eksternal (misalnya, Gateway Pembayaran).
  • Pernyataan Masalah:Deskripsi singkat mengenai masalah yang perlu diatasi atau kondisi yang perlu ditingkatkan. AI menggunakan ini sebagai benih untuk menghasilkan kebutuhan.
  • Markdown:Bahasa markup ringan dengan sintaks format teks biasa. Ini adalah format standar untuk mengekspor dokumentasi berbasis teks bagi pengembang.

Petunjuk: Alur Kerja Langkah demi Langkah

Untukmenghasilkan deskripsi kasus penggunaan profesionalsecara efektif, ikuti proses empat langkah terstruktur ini menggunakan alat berbasis AI. Alur kerja ini dirancang untuk bergerak dari ketidakjelasan tingkat tinggi ke detail teknis yang mendalam.

Langkah 1: Hasilkan Deskripsi Masalah

Kualitas output AI sangat tergantung pada kejelasan input. Mulailah dengan memasukkan ringkasan prompt mengenai ide proyek Anda. AI akan menganalisis input ini untuk menghasilkan pernyataan masalah yang rinci.

Saran yang dapat diambil:Periksa pernyataan yang dihasilkan dengan cermat. Karena alat ini memungkinkan pengeditan, pastikan cakupannya akurat sebelum melanjutkan. Pernyataan ini berfungsi sebagai konteks untuk semua kasus penggunaan selanjutnya.

Langkah 2: Identifikasi Kasus Penggunaan Kandidat

Setelah masalah didefinisikan, AI berperan sebagai analis bisnis. Ia memindai pernyataan masalah untukmengidentifikasi interaksi potensialdan persyaratan fungsional. Ia akan menampilkan daftar (sering dalam format tabel) yang berisi kasus penggunaan penting bersama aktor utamanya.

Mengapa hal ini penting:Langkah ini memastikan cakupan yang komprehensif. Analisis otomatis sering kali menangkap persyaratan atau kasus-kasus tepi yang mungkin terlewat dalam brainstorming manual.

Langkah 3: Buat Laporan Rinci

Dari daftar kandidat, pilih kasus penggunaan tertentu untuk diperluas. AI akanmenghasilkan laporan lengkapuntuk pilihan tersebut. Laporan ini biasanya mencakup prasyarat, alur utama, alur alternatif, dan kondisi akhir.

Mengekspor:Laporan-laporan ini biasanya dapat diekspor langsung sebagai dokumentasi Markdown profesional, sehingga siap digunakan untuk repositori GitHub atau wiki teknis.

Langkah 4: Visualisasikan dan Sempurnakan Diagram

Teks sering kali tidak cukup untuk menyampaikan logika yang kompleks. Langkah terakhir melibatkan mengubah kasus penggunaan teks menjadidiagram visual. Alat seperti Visual Paradigm Online memungkinkan Anda membuka diagram yang dihasilkan danhaluskan.

  • Visualisasi: Menyediakan peta tingkat tinggi tentang fungsi sistem.
  • Haluskan: Memberi Anda kendali penuh untuk menyesuaikan hubungan dan tata letak secara manual setelah AI menyediakan kerangka awal.

Manfaat Utama Analisis Berbasis AI

Mengadopsi alur kerja yang didukung AI menawarkan keunggulan yang jelas dibandingkan metode dokumentasi tradisional:

Manfaat Deskripsi
Klaritas yang Dipercepat Beralih dari ide yang samar menjadi deskripsi masalah yang terstruktur dalam hitungan detik, menghemat jam-jam penulisan manual.
Cakupan yang Komprehensif Algoritma AI membantumengidentifikasi aktor dan kasus penggunaanyang mungkin Anda lewatkan, memastikan peta jalan fungsi yang kuat.
Integrasi yang Mulus Kemampuan untuk mengekspor ke Markdown atau mengedit diagram langsung di editor berbasis cloud mendukung kolaborasi yang agil.

Kiat dan Trik untuk Sukses

Maximalkan efisiensi dariPembuat Kasus Penggunaan AIdengan praktik terbaik berikut:

  • Bersifat Spesifik dengan Permintaan:Saat membuat deskripsi masalah awal Anda, sertakan industri target dan tujuan utama (misalnya, “Aplikasi seluler untuk jadwal perawatan hewan peliharaan” dibandingkan dengan “Aplikasi jadwal”).
  • Lakukan iterasi pada Diagram:AI menghasilkan titik awal yang logis, tetapi kejelasan visual sering kali memerlukan sentuhan manusia. Gunakan editor untuk mengelompokkan aktor yang terkait atau memberi warna pada jalur kritis.
  • Gabungkan Format:Jangan hanya mengandalkan diagram atau teks. Dokumen spesifikasi profesional harus mencakup diagram visual diikuti oleh laporan Markdown yang rinci untuk memastikan kejelasan maksimal.
  • Audit Aktor:AI mungkin menyarankan nama aktor yang umum (misalnya, “Pengguna”). Ubah nama tersebut menjadi peran yang spesifik (misalnya, “Anggota Terdaftar” atau “Tamu”) selama tahap pengeditan untuk presisi yang lebih baik.

Kesimpulan

Bergerak dari dokumentasi sederhana ke inovasi membutuhkan alat yang mengurangi pekerjaan ulang dan mempercepat waktu peluncuran ke pasar. Dengan memanfaatkan AI untuk menghasilkan deskripsi kasus penggunaan, Anda memastikan proyek Anda dibangun di atas dasar yang jelas dan profesional. Baik Anda sedangmenghasilkan laporan rinciatau memvisualisasikan persyaratan yang kompleks, teknologi ini memungkinkan Anda fokus pada menyelesaikan masalah daripada memformat dokumen.

Sidebar
Loading

Signing-in 3 seconds...

Signing-up 3 seconds...